About Médiévales Thillombois

The Médiévales du Château de Thillombois are a major medieval event organized by Connaissance de la Meuse in the castle park. For two days in September, over 130 costumed participants offer knight tournaments, armored combat, musicians, encampments, workshops, and banquets. The castle, located between Verdun and Bar-le-Duc, provides an ideal setting for this medieval immersion.

ℹ️ No event in 2026. The Les Médiévales du château de Thillombois festival debuted on September 20th and 21st, 2025. For 2026, the Connaissance de la Meuse schedule does not include a medieval festival; instead, the 7th Equestrian Biennale will take place in the park from September 18th to 20th. The association intends to make Les Médiévales a biennial event, though no dates have been announced for the next edition.

The inaugural edition in September 2025

Les Médiévales launched on September 20th and 21st, 2025, two years after a one-day medieval festival was held at the same location. Over 130 costumed participants brought the park to life over the weekend, featuring a grand jousting tournament by the Compagnie Icario, buhurt combat by Lotharii Regnum, four encampments, two musical troupes, a wooden climbing tower, children's activities, and two medieval meals available by reservation.

Prices Médiévales Thillombois 2026

No tickets for 2026, as the event is not taking place this year. For reference, the 2025 rates were: adults €18, youths aged 7 to 15 €12, free for children under 7, and family passes (2 adults + 2 youths) €54. Medieval meals by reservation: €28 for adults, €13 for children up to 12. Rapido meal deal €8 (chicken mayo sandwich, chips, cookie, 50 cl water).
Practical information

Practical information — Médiévales Thillombois

Access and Transport

The Médiévales are held at the Château de Thillombois (55260), on the D121 between Verdun and Bar-le-Duc.

  • By car: From Verdun, follow the D903 then the D121 towards Thillombois (approx. 30 km). From Bar-le-Duc, take the D121 (approx. 25 km). Free parking on site.
  • By train: Nearest stations: Verdun or Bar-le-Duc (TGV and TER Grand Est).

Opening Hours

Saturday: 1:45 PM to 7:30 PM with tournaments, shows, encampments, and workshops. Sunday: 9:45 AM to 7:30 PM, full program from the morning with demonstrations, shows, and continuous entertainment.

Prices

Adult: €18. Young person (7-15 years): €12. Child (under 7 years): free. Family (2 adults + 2 young people): €54. All activities, shows, workshops, games, and exhibitions are included in the entrance fee.

Medieval Banquet

Medieval meals are served on Saturday evening and Sunday lunchtime, by reservation only: €28 adult / €13 child. The menu includes dishes inspired by medieval recipes and drinks. For a lighter option, a quick service area offers sandwiches, quiches, and crepes (Rapido combo for €8).

Recommendations

Wear comfortable shoes for walking around the castle grounds. In case of rain, the program continues: bring waterproof clothing. Wearing a medieval costume is encouraged. Animals are not allowed on the site. Children's tickets must be booked in advance.

Total immersion in the Middle Ages

The Médiévales du Château de Thillombois offer a unique experience: two days of complete immersion in the Middle Ages. Organized by the association Connaissance de la Meuse, this event transforms the park and castle of Thillombois into a true living medieval village, with over 130 costumed participants animating the grounds from morning to night.

Knight Tournaments and Battles

The grand knight tournaments are the highlight of the event. The Compagnie Icario presents breathtaking jousts and equestrian demonstrations, several times a day. Armored combat, animated by the companies Lotharii Regnum and other reenactment troupes, offers an impressive display of medieval combat techniques.

Music and Shows

Musicians in period costumes roam the grounds, playing on copies of medieval instruments displayed inside the castle. Acrobats, jugglers, and jesters entertain in the park alleys, recreating the festive atmosphere of a medieval fair. A special show for young audiences, such as "The Secret of the Unicorn Goat", delights the little ones.

Encampments and Workshops

Numerous medieval encampments are set up in the castle park, offering a fascinating glimpse into daily life in the Middle Ages. Visitors can observe demonstrations of medieval cooking, archery, blacksmithing, weaving, and learn about the operation of a medieval cannon. Creative workshops allow children to discover the arts and crafts of the era.

Medieval Banquets

One of the event's highlights is the medieval banquet, served on Saturday evening and Sunday lunchtime by reservation. For €28 per adult and €13 per child, guests enjoy a menu inspired by medieval recipes, accompanied by drinks, in a festive and musical atmosphere. For those preferring a lighter option, a quick service area offers sandwiches, quiches, and crepes.
